Exercise-induced hypertension in men with metabolic syndrome: anthropometric, metabolic, and hemodynamic features.

Abstract

OBJECTIVE

Metabolic syndrome is associated with increased cardiac morbidity. The aim of this study was to evaluate exercise-induced hypertension (EIH) in men with metabolic syndrome and to explore potential associations with anthropometric and metabolic variables.

METHODS

A total of 179 normotensive men with metabolic syndrome underwent a maximal symptom-limited treadmill test. Blood pressure was measured at 5-min rest prior to exercise testing (anticipatory blood pressure), at every 3 min during the exercise, and during the recovery period. EIH was defined as maximum systolic blood pressure (SBP) ≥220 mmHg and/or maximum diastolic blood pressure (DBP) ≥100 mmHg.

RESULTS

Of the 179 men, 87 (47%) presented EIH. Resting blood pressure values at baseline were 127±10/83±6 mmHg in EIH and 119±9/80±6 mmHg (P=0.01 for both) in normal blood pressure responders to exercise. Anticipatory SBP and DPS were higher in the group with EIH (P=0.001). Subjects with EIH presented higher waist circumference (WC) (P<0.01), low-density lipoprotein cholesterol (LDL-C), and apolipoprotein B (ApoB) levels as well as insulin resistance (all P<0.05). Abdominal subcutaneous adipose tissue and total body fat mass were comparable between groups. Subjects with EIH had higher abdominal visceral adipose tissue (P<0.001). The best predictors of EIH were resting SBP and abdominal obesity. Each increment of 5 cm in WC was associated with an odds ratio of 1.30 (1.20-1.68) for EIH.

CONCLUSION

About half of our subjects with metabolic syndrome showed EIH. These men are characterized by a worsened metabolic profile. Our data suggest that a treadmill exercise test may be helpful to identify a potentially higher risk metabolic syndrome subset of subjects.

摘要

目的

代谢综合征与心脏发病率增加有关。本研究旨在评估代谢综合征男性的运动诱导性高血压(EIH),并探讨其与人体测量和代谢变量的潜在关联。

方法

共有 179 名血压正常的代谢综合征男性接受了最大症状限制跑步机测试。在运动测试前的 5 分钟休息时(预期血压)、运动期间每 3 分钟以及恢复期间测量血压。EIH 定义为最大收缩压(SBP)≥220mmHg 和/或最大舒张压(DBP)≥100mmHg。

结果

在 179 名男性中,87 名(47%)出现 EIH。EIH 组静息血压值为 127±10/83±6mmHg,运动后正常血压反应者为 119±9/80±6mmHg(均 P<0.01)。EIH 组的预期 SBP 和 DPS 更高(P=0.001)。EIH 组的腰围(WC)(P<0.01)、低密度脂蛋白胆固醇(LDL-C)和载脂蛋白 B(ApoB)水平以及胰岛素抵抗更高(均 P<0.05)。两组间的腹部皮下脂肪组织和全身脂肪量无差异。EIH 组的腹部内脏脂肪组织更高(P<0.001)。EIH 的最佳预测因子是静息 SBP 和腹型肥胖。WC 每增加 5cm,EIH 的比值比为 1.30(1.20-1.68)。

结论

我们的研究对象中约有一半患有代谢综合征,表现出 EIH。这些男性的代谢特征更为恶化。我们的数据表明,跑步机运动测试可能有助于识别代谢综合征中潜在的高风险亚组。
